9. FISCAL UPDATE
Source - https://economics.bmo.com/en/publications/detail/4eaa72b1-7c11-45d3-927a-cc2227536362/
• Liberals cuts tax rates but made up for those tax cuts
• Liberals are leading to a structure deficit which means higher
taxes, like GST. Each point of GST is worth about $5B.
• New Taxes or Hikes
• Elimination of boutique tax credits
• Hikes to CPP
• Estimated costs $150 to $300 more per year -
https://www.newswire.ca/news-releases/january-1-
cpp-hikes-to-hit-employers-payroll-budgets-cut-
take-home-wages-for-workers-805159419.html
• Carbon Tax is adding $1,400 to 2,000K additional costs
to households -
https://www2.slideshare.net/paulyoungcga/the-real-
truth-about-emissions-and-carbon-taxation
• Fuel Standard change / new carbon tax
• Estimated Costs $500 to $1,000 per household -
https://www.newswire.ca/news-releases/clean-
fuels-standard-will-increase-household-costs-for-
canadians-capp-819531042.html
